内容分发网络(Content Delivery Network,简称CDN)是现代互联网架构中不可或缺的一环,随着数字化时代的到来,用户对互联网内容的访问速度和体验要求越来越高,CDN的作用显得尤为重要,本文将探讨CDN的基本概念、原理、技术、优势以及面临的挑战。
一、CDN的基本概述
CDN是一种通过在全球各地分布的节点服务器来加速内容传输的网络,它利用缓存、负载均衡等技术,将用户请求导向距离最近或负载最低的节点,从而提升内容交付的速度和稳定性。
CDN的概念最早可以追溯到20世纪90年代,当时,随着互联网用户数量的增加,跨地域的内容传输速度慢、网络拥堵等问题日益突出,Akamai Technologies公司于1998年成立,并于1999年建立了世界上第一个CDN网络,标志着CDN技术的正式诞生。
CDN的工作原理主要包括以下几个方面:内容提供商将内容上传至CDN网络;CDN通过网络中的节点服务器将内容缓存到各地;当用户发起请求时,CDN会根据预设的策略将请求导向最佳的节点服务器,从而快速响应用户。
二、CDN的技术解析
CDN依赖于高效的内容存储和分发技术,缓存服务器分布在各地,当用户请求内容时,CDN会根据地理位置、服务器负载等因素,将请求导向最近的缓存服务器,这样可以显著减少内容传输的延迟,提高用户体验。
负载均衡是CDN的另一项核心技术,通过智能调度,CDN可以将用户请求均匀分配到各个节点,避免单一节点过载,负载均衡不仅提高了服务的可靠性,还优化了资源利用率。
管理在CDN中同样至关重要,CDN需要对缓存的内容进行高效管理,包括内容的更新、淘汰和安全控制,CDN还需要提供强大的监控和分析工具,以便实时了解网络状态和用户行为。三、CDN的优势与应用
CDN通过将内容缓存到靠近用户的节点,显著减少了传输延迟,加快了网页加载速度,这对于提升用户体验至关重要,因为研究表明,网页加载时间每增加一秒,用户满意度就会显著下降。
通过缓存和负载均衡,CDN有效分担了源站的负载压力,这不仅提升了源站的处理能力,还增强了其稳定性和安全性,尤其在面对大规模流量攻击时表现尤为突出。
CDN的分布式架构使得即便某一节点出现故障,其他节点仍然可以正常工作,从而提高了整体服务的可靠性,通过实时监控和智能调度,CDN还能提前预警和处理潜在问题。
对于跨国企业而言,CDN能够确保全球用户都能享受到一致的访问速度和体验,这有助于企业拓展海外市场,增强全球竞争力,Netflix通过部署CDN,确保了全球用户都能流畅观看高清视频。
四、CDN的挑战与发展
尽管CDN已经在全球范围内部署了大量节点,但随着互联网的快速发展,尤其是移动互联网和物联网的普及,如何进一步优化节点布局依然是一个重要的课题。
CDN作为内容传输的重要枢纽,面临着各种安全威胁,如DDoS攻击和数据泄露等,加强CDN的安全性,提供全面的安全防护措施,是未来的重要发展方向。
随着5G、边缘计算等新技术的发展,如何将这些新技术与CDN结合,进一步提升内容分发效率,也是业界关注的焦点,利用边缘计算在更靠近用户的位置处理数据,可以进一步降低延迟,提高传输效率。
CDN作为现代互联网架构中的关键组成部分,极大地提升了内容传输的效率和用户体验,随着技术的不断进步和用户需求的变化,CDN将继续发挥其重要作用,推动互联网的发展。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态